What cats by color heal people? - in detail

The belief that cats of certain colors possess healing properties is deeply rooted in various cultures and traditions around the world. This phenomenon is often attributed to the symbolic and spiritual significance associated with different feline colors. Understanding these associations can provide insight into how cats are perceived as healers in different societies.

White cats, for instance, are often seen as symbols of purity and innocence. In many cultures, they are believed to bring good luck and ward off evil spirits. Their pristine appearance is often linked to healing and protective energies. White cats are frequently associated with divine or spiritual entities, making them popular in religious and spiritual practices. In some traditions, white cats are believed to have the ability to heal emotional wounds and provide comfort during times of distress.

Black cats, on the other hand, have a more complex reputation. While they are often associated with bad luck in Western cultures, in many other parts of the world, they are revered for their healing properties. Black cats are believed to absorb negative energy and protect their owners from harm. They are also thought to have the ability to heal physical ailments, particularly those related to the nervous system. In ancient Egyptian culture, black cats were highly revered and were believed to have protective and healing powers.

Orange or ginger cats are often associated with warmth, energy, and vitality. They are believed to bring joy and happiness into the lives of their owners. Orange cats are thought to have the ability to heal emotional and psychological issues, providing a sense of comfort and security. Their vibrant color is often linked to the sun and its life-giving properties, making them symbols of renewal and healing.

Gray or blue cats are believed to have a calming and soothing effect on their owners. They are often associated with tranquility and peace. Gray cats are thought to have the ability to heal mental and emotional stress, providing a sense of balance and harmony. Their color is often linked to the sky and the ocean, symbols of vastness and depth, which can be healing for those seeking inner peace.

In some cultures, multi-colored or tortoiseshell cats are believed to have unique healing properties. These cats are thought to possess a blend of the energies associated with each of their colors. Tortoiseshell cats are often seen as symbols of balance and harmony, and they are believed to have the ability to heal a wide range of ailments, both physical and emotional.
